On January 29, 2025, a traffic incident occurred on Route 198 West in Buffalo, New York, causing significant disruptions during the morning commute. The crash took place just beyond Parkside Avenue, a well-known thoroughfare in the area, at approximately 7:23 AM. As a result of the accident, the right lane of Route 198 West was closed, leading to delays and congestion for drivers navigating this busy roadway.

Route 198, also known as the Scajaquada Expressway, is a crucial connector within the city, linking various neighborhoods and providing access to key destinations such as Delaware Park and the Buffalo Zoo. The expressway’s location near Parkside Avenue, a street lined with historic homes and lush greenery, makes it a vital route for both local residents and visitors.
